Default TOP problem

I don't drive my Z every day but maybe every 3 - 4 days. I've had no problems out of it. I leave it parked in my garage with the windows down but the top up.

Today i tried to lower the top and nothing happened. I tried everything. I can hear a "clicking" sound in the door pannels around where the window switches are. My window work perfectly.

The car is out of warrenty and i'm not sure what to do or even where to take the car. I tried to get a Haynes manual to see if i could fix the problem but there isn't a manual available. Anyone have any ideas?

I don't know if this is the same case, but a few weeks ago my top would not open. I finally found out that the brake light switch (right above the brake pedal) wasn't functioning. Since you have to have the brake depressed for the top to go down, it wouldn't work. After some WD-40 and messing with it for awhile it worked again and I haven't had any problems with it since. There are two switches on the brake pedal, I believe it was the lower of the two.

First off i really do not know what it could be. With that said if it was my car and I was certain it had something to do with the door i would take off the door panel and see if I could find the clicking sound. i would look for some type of limit switch of something that has to make contact with something in the door before it allows the top to go down. It sounds like what ever insures the windows are down before the top is allowed to go down is not working properly. I hope this helps somewhat.
